The cpu_efficiency values were originally derived from the "Big.LITTLE Processing with ARM Cortex™-A15 & Cortex-A7" white paper (http://www.cl.cam.ac.uk/~rdm34/big.LITTLE.pdf). Table 1 lists 1.9x (3891/2048) as the Cortex-A15 vs Cortex-A7 performance ratio for the Dhrystone benchmark.
